The partnership between Medable, U.S. Renal Care, and the top ten pharmaceutical sponsor exemplifies the transformative power of Medable’s Total Consent solution in clinical trials. By overcoming common misconceptions around participant age, cost, and complexity, Medable’s platform proved to be a flexible, fast, and efficient solution for the elderly renal care population. U.S. Renal Care sought to use Medable’s Total Consent (Medable’s eConsent solution) for an investigator-initiated trial. The phase 4 trial, which was funded by a top 10 pharmaceutical company, sought to enroll elderly participants suffering from Anemia ESKD (End Stage Kidney Disease) across 476 site users. The trial would be managed by three central principal investigators (PIs).

A top-10 global pharmaceutical company came to Medable looking to standardize and scale their weight management trials. The trial was driven by a master protocol with multiple sub-studies across 70+ research sites. The partner was concerned about the participant and site experience, particularly participant enrollment and study startup timelines, as the trial required participants to enroll through the master protocol before enrolling into a sub-study.
